Comment réparer l'erreur Rundll32 a cessé de fonctionner

Continuez-vous à recevoir une erreur « Le processus hôte Windows ( Rundll32 ) a cessé de fonctionner » lors de l'utilisation de Windows 10 ? Cette erreur apparaît principalement lorsque vous essayez d'ouvrir ou d'interagir avec des programmes spécifiques (natifs ou tiers) sur votre ordinateur. Mais cela peut aussi vous harceler au hasard sans raison apparente. Pourquoi cela arrive-t-il?

Windows 10 utilise le processus Rundll32 pour exécuter des fichiers DLL ( bibliothèque de liens dynamiques(dynamic-link library) ) 32 bits . Ces fichiers contiennent des fonctions partagées entre plusieurs applications. Cependant, des logiciels en conflit, des paramètres mal configurés ou des fichiers système corrompus peuvent entraîner la panne de Rundll32 , d'où la raison de l'erreur.(Rundll32)

L'erreur "Rundll32 a cessé de fonctionner" afflige les utilisateurs de Windows depuis des années, mais plusieurs correctifs peuvent vous aider à vous en débarrasser. Nous vous recommandons de suivre les méthodes de dépannage ci-dessous dans l'ordre dans lequel elles apparaissent. N'hésitez(Feel) pas à sauter ceux qui ne s'appliquent pas.

Désactiver les aperçus des vignettes

Continuez-vous à rencontrer l'erreur "Rundll32 a cessé de fonctionner" lors de l'utilisation de l' explorateur de fichiers(File Explorer) ? La désactivation des aperçus miniatures peut aider.

1. Ouvrez l'explorateur de fichiers.

2. Sélectionnez l' onglet Affichage . (View )Ensuite, sélectionnez Options pour afficher la boîte de dialogue Options des dossiers .(Folder Options)

3. Passez à l' onglet Affichage .(View )

4. Cochez la case à côté de Toujours afficher les icônes, jamais les vignettes(Always show icons, never thumbnails) .

5. Sélectionnez Appliquer(Apply) , puis OK , pour enregistrer les modifications.

Exécutez l'utilitaire de résolution des problèmes de fichiers et de dossiers

Si l' Explorateur de fichiers(File Explorer) continue d'afficher le message d'erreur " Rundll32 a cessé de fonctionner" malgré la désactivation des aperçus des vignettes, essayez d'exécuter l' utilitaire de résolution des problèmes de fichiers(File) et de dossiers(Folder Troubleshooter) .

1. Téléchargez l' utilitaire de résolution des problèmes de fichiers et de dossiers(File and Folder Troubleshooter) de Microsoft.

2. Ouvrez l' utilitaire de résolution des problèmes de fichiers(File) et de dossiers, vous(Folder Troubleshooter—you) n'avez pas besoin de l'installer.

3. Sélectionnez Avancé(Advanced) , cochez la case en regard de Appliquer les réparations automatiquement(Apply repairs automatically ) (si elle n'est pas déjà cochée) et sélectionnez Suivant(Next) .

4. Sélectionnez toutes les options dans l' écran Quel type de problèmes rencontrez-vous(What kind of problems are you experiencing ) et sélectionnez Suivant(Next) .

5. Suivez les invites à l'écran pour résoudre les problèmes détectés par l'utilitaire de résolution des problèmes de fichiers(File) et de dossiers(Folder Troubleshooter) .

Mettre(Update) à jour , réinstaller(Reinstall) ou désinstaller des programmes

Le(Did) problème est-il survenu après l'installation d'une application particulière sur votre ordinateur ? Par exemple, des programmes tels que Nero et le pack de codecs K-Lite(K-Lite Codec Pack) ont l'habitude de provoquer l'erreur « Rundll32 a cessé de fonctionner ».

Si c'est le cas, essayez de mettre à jour ou de réinstaller le programme. Si cela ne fonctionne pas, vous pouvez envisager de le supprimer(removing it from your computer) complètement de votre ordinateur.

Désactiver les services et les programmes de démarrage(Startup Programs)

Les services d'arrière-plan tiers et les programmes de démarrage peuvent également entraîner l' erreur Rundll32 . Vérifiez si la désactivation de ces aides. Vous pouvez ensuite passer par un processus d'élimination pour déterminer l'élément exact à l'origine du problème.

Désactiver les services tiers - Configuration du système(Disable Third-Party Services – System Configuration)

1. Appuyez sur Windows+R pour ouvrir la boîte Exécuter. Ensuite, tapez msconfig et sélectionnez OK .

2. Passez à l' onglet Services . Ensuite, cochez la case à côté de Masquer tous les services Microsoft(Hide all Microsoft services ) (qui ne révèle alors que les services tiers) et sélectionnez Désactiver tout(Disable all)

3. Sélectionnez Appliquer(Apply) , puis OK , pour enregistrer les modifications. Sélectionnez Quitter sans redémarrer(Exit without restart ) lorsque vous y êtes invité.

Désactiver les programmes de démarrage – Gestionnaire des tâches(Disable Startup Programs – Task Manager)

1. Cliquez avec le bouton droit sur la barre des tâches et sélectionnez Gestionnaire(Task Manager) des tâches .

2. Sélectionnez Plus de détails(More Details) .

3. Passez à l' onglet Démarrage .(Startup)

4. Choisissez chaque programme de démarrage tiers et sélectionnez Désactiver(Disable) .

5. Fermez le Gestionnaire des tâches. 

Redémarrez votre ordinateur. Si l' erreur Rundll32 ne s'affiche plus, commencez à réactiver quelques services et programmes de démarrage à la fois. Cela devrait vous aider à identifier l'élément problématique. Vous pouvez ensuite mettre à jour le programme concerné ou le supprimer de votre ordinateur.

Restauration des pilotes audio/vidéo

L'erreur "Rundll32 a cessé de fonctionner" peut apparaître après la mise à jour des pilotes audio ou vidéo. Par exemple, les pilotes de Realtek , Sound Blaster et NVIDIA peuvent provoquer cela dans de rares cas. Utilisez le Gestionnaire(Device Manager) de périphériques de Windows 10 pour les restaurer.

1. Cliquez avec le bouton droit sur le bouton Démarrer(Start ) et sélectionnez Gestionnaire de périphériques(Device Manager) .

2. Développez Contrôleurs audio, vidéo et jeu(Sound, video and game controllers)

3. Cliquez avec le bouton droit sur le pilote audio et sélectionnez Propriétés(Properties) .

4. Passez à l' onglet Pilote et sélectionnez (Driver )Restaurer le pilote(Roll Back Driver) . Répétez l'opération pour tous les autres pilotes de la liste.

5. Développez la section Adaptateurs d'affichage(Display Adapters ) dans le Gestionnaire de périphériques(Device Manager) et répétez les étapes 3 et 4 .

Mettre à jour les pilotes audio/vidéo

Si la restauration des pilotes audio et vidéo n'a pas aidé (ou si vous n'avez pas pu les restaurer plus tôt), essayez plutôt de les mettre à jour.

1. Ouvrez le Gestionnaire de périphériques.

2. Développez Contrôleurs audio, vidéo et jeu(Sound, video and game controllers)

3. Cliquez avec le bouton droit sur le pilote audio et sélectionnez Mettre à jour le pilote(Update Driver) .

4. Sélectionnez Rechercher automatiquement les pilotes(Search automatically for drivers) pour rechercher et appliquer automatiquement les derniers pilotes. Répétez(Repeat) l'opération pour tous les autres pilotes de la liste.

5. Développez la section Display Adapters et répétez les étapes 3 et 4 .

Alternativement, vous pouvez télécharger les derniers pilotes audio ou vidéo directement depuis le site Web du fabricant et les mettre à jour manuellement.

Mettre à jour Windows 10

Une version obsolète de Windows 10 peut entraîner toutes sortes de problèmes. Si vous n'avez pas mis à jour votre ordinateur depuis un certain temps, essayez de le faire maintenant.

1. Ouvrez le menu Démarrer(Start) , tapez Windows Update et sélectionnez Ouvrir(Open) .

2. Sélectionnez Vérifier les mises à jour(Check for updates) .

3. Installez les mises à jour, si disponibles.

Désactiver la prévention de l'exécution des données

La prévention de l'exécution des données(Data Execution Prevention) ( DEP ) est une fonctionnalité de Windows 10 qui surveille et protège la mémoire système contre les attaques malveillantes. Cependant, cela peut empêcher le processus Rundll32 de fonctionner correctement. Vérifiez si la désactivation du DEP(DEP) aide.

1. Ouvrez le menu Démarrer(Start ) , tapez invite de commande(command prompt) et sélectionnez Exécuter en tant qu'administrateur(Run as administrator) .

2. Copiez et collez la commande suivante dans la console d' invite de commande élevée :(Command Prompt)

bcdedit.exe /set {current} nx AlwaysOff 

3. Appuyez sur Entrée(Enter ) pour désactiver DEP.

Cela a- t(Did) -il corrigé l'erreur « Rundll32 a cessé de fonctionner » ? Si oui, vous voudrez peut-être continuer avec le reste des correctifs car garder DEP désactivé est un risque de sécurité.

Remarque :(Note:) Pour activer la prévention(Data Execution Prevention) de l'exécution des données ultérieurement, exécutez la commande suivante dans une console d' invite de commande élevée :(Command Prompt)

bcdedit.exe /set {current} nx AlwaysOn

Rechercher les logiciels malveillants

Les programmes malveillants peuvent se faire passer pour des fichiers DLL et finir par provoquer des erreurs "Rundll32 a cessé de fonctionner". Essayez d'utiliser la sécurité Windows(Windows Security) pour analyser votre ordinateur à la recherche de logiciels malveillants.

1. Ouvrez le menu Démarrer(Start ) , tapez sécurité Windows(windows security) et sélectionnez Ouvrir(Open) .

2. Sélectionnez Protection contre les virus et menaces(Virus & threat protection) .

3. Sélectionnez Options de numérisation(Scan options) .

4. Sélectionnez Analyse complète(Full scan) . Ensuite, sélectionnez Analyser maintenant(Scan now) .

Si la sécurité Windows(Windows Security) n'a rien trouvé, nous vous recommandons d'utiliser un outil de suppression de logiciels malveillants dédié tel que Malwarebytes pour un nettoyage en profondeur de l'ordinateur.

Exécuter une analyse SFC

Une analyse SFC ( System File Checker ) vous permet de détecter et de réparer les fichiers système corrompus qui empêchent le processus Rundll32 de s'exécuter correctement.

1. Ouvrez le menu Démarrer(Start ) , tapez invite de commande(command prompt) et sélectionnez Exécuter en tant qu'administrateur(Run as administrator) .

2. Entrez la commande suivante :

sfc /scannow

3. Appuyez sur Entrée(Enter)

L' analyse SFC peut prendre plusieurs minutes.

Exécuter une analyse DISM

Si l' analyse SFC n'a pas réussi à trouver et à résoudre les problèmes, exécutez plutôt une analyse DISM(DISM) ( Deployment Image Servicing and Management ).

1. Ouvrez le menu Démarrer(Start ) , tapez invite de commande(command prompt) , puis sélectionnez Exécuter en tant qu'administrateur(Run as administrator) .

2. Exécutez la commande suivante :

DISM /Online /Cleanup-Image /CheckHealth

3. Si DISM a(DISM) fini par détecter des problèmes sur votre ordinateur, exécutez les commandes suivantes l'une après l'autre.

DISM /Online /Cleanup-Image /ScanHealth

DISM /Online /Cleanup-Image /RestoreHealth

Que pouvez vous faire d'autre?

Si aucun des correctifs ci-dessus n'a résolu l'erreur "Le processus hôte Windows ( Rundll32 ) a cessé de fonctionner", vous pouvez effectuer une réinitialisation d'usine de Windows 10(Windows 10 factory reset) en accédant à Démarrer(Start ) > Paramètres(Settings ) > Mise à jour et sécurité(Update & Security) > Récupération(Recovery) . Vous pouvez choisir entre conserver ou supprimer vos fichiers et programmes pendant la procédure de réinitialisation.

Vous pouvez également essayer de réinstaller Windows 10(re-installing Windows 10) . Il pourrait y avoir un problème sous-jacent profond que seule une réinstallation complète du système d'exploitation peut résoudre. N'oubliez(Just) pas de créer une sauvegarde complète de vos données(complete backup of your data) au préalable.



About the author

Je suis un technicien Windows 10 et j'aide les particuliers et les entreprises à tirer parti du nouveau système d'exploitation depuis de nombreuses années. J'ai une richesse de connaissances sur Microsoft Office, y compris comment personnaliser l'apparence et personnaliser les applications pour différents utilisateurs. De plus, je sais utiliser l'application Explorer pour explorer et rechercher des fichiers et des dossiers sur mon ordinateur.



Related posts